dh-winternagi 님의 블로그
(1152) 단어의 개수 본문
https://www.acmicpc.net/problem/1152
단계별로 풀어보기
5단계(문자열) 8번째
초반 문제 주제에 공백이라는 엣지 케이스까지 생각해야 하는 문제
아무리 생각해도 테케나 입력 설명 중 하나는 바뀌어야 할 것 같은데...

#include <iostream>
using namespace std;
int main()
{
int ans= 0;
string s;
bool flag= false;
getline(cin, s);
for(char c:s){
if(c-' '){
if(!flag){
flag= true;
ans++;
}
}else{
flag= false;
}
}
cout << ans;
return 0;
}'백준 (C++) > Solve' 카테고리의 다른 글
| (5622) 다이얼 (0) | 2026.04.10 |
|---|---|
| (2908) 상수 (0) | 2026.04.10 |
| (2675) 문자열 반복 (0) | 2026.04.10 |
| (10809) 알파벳 찾기 (0) | 2026.04.10 |
| (11720) 숫자의 합 (0) | 2026.04.10 |
